Question

Which type of phyllotaxy can be found in Alstonia?


Open in App
Solution

Alstonia:

  1. Alstonia is the evergreen tree that belongs to the family Apocynaceae.
  2. It secretes the latex milky white exudates.
  3. Phyllotaxy is an arrangement in which the leaves arrange themselves on the branches.
  4. Alstonia has a whorled phyllotaxy.
  5. In whorled phyllotaxy, the two or more leaves originate from a single node, and form a whorl.
